Cluster partners cover entire value chain

With their specific skills, the partners from science and business networked in the excellence cluster Forum Organic Electronics cover different areas of the organic electronics value chain, so that together they cover it completely: starting with materials development, to the production of components and systems, all the way to the production and sale of new applications. The partners are involved in cooperation along the entire value chain, not just in relation to the next step. The aim is to integrate real market needs into the research work of all those involved at an early stage, in order to avoid so-called over-engineering and to achieve fast, target-oriented research results.

Development of materials

Since organic electronics is still in its early stages, there is currently a significant focus on the development of suitable organic materials for the production of the electronic components required. The excellence cluster is in an excellent position in this area. With the world's largest chemicals corporation BASF SE and the world market leader in liquid crystals for LED screens, Merck KGaA, the excellence cluster has the greatest industrial expertise in the world in material development at its disposal. This is ideally complemented on the part of universities, for example by the scientific and technical skills of the elite Universities of Heidelberg and Karlsruhe.

Manufacture of components and systems

Further leading companies are active in the excellence cluster in the manufacture of components and systems. For example,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G, the world market leader in offset printing machinery, is working on the development of a printing technology for electronic components based on organic materials, which will be necessary for cost-effective mass production.

Marketing of products and applications

The application side, too, is outstandingly represented in the excellence cluster. Lighting manufacturers such as Osram and Philips are working towards marketing lighting systems with organic light diodes. Roche Diagnostics GmbH is aiming to introduce organic sensors for glucose measurement. SAP AG is developing software which maps the new business processes made possible by smart labels.
